Abstract
For an n-dimensional bounded domain we derive some inequalities bounding the norm of a square tensor field. Concerning the Div-Dev-inequality the bound is given by the trace-free part and the divergence and the tensor. In the case of the DevSym-Curl-inequality the bound is given by the trace-free and symmetric part and the curl of the tensor. For n=3 the bound is given by the trace-free symmetric part of the tensor and the trace-free part of the curl of the tensor. Some prototype applications are presented in which the new inequalities may be used to derive the coercivity of the models.
